The NFL totals for the 2023-24 season were released yesterday. All of the props, team totals, and of course the one we all care about, the Super Bowl odds have been posted. What are the Cardinals Super Bowl Odds, and how accurate are they?

The Arizona Cardinals are tied for dead last in the odds with the Houston Texans. Now that is a shocker, the Cardinals seemed to be a few steps ahead of the Texans as far as competing.

The odds on both teams according to Barstool Sports Book are +17500, or for the fraction lovers, 175/1.

Cardinals Super Bowl Odds…

Are the Cardinals Super Bowl odds accurate? Well yes, and no. The fact is that the Arizona Cardinals are a long ways a way from a Super Bowl.

Wait, are they? Arizona has just brought in a new General Manager, and a slew of new coaches including new head coach. After a season of dealing with one of the worse injury bugs in the league, they will look to get back healthy.

They already have who they are calling their “franchise” quarterback, which should put them ahead of some teams who are in a drastic panic at who will start under center come August.

However even with that, the team is ranked last in almost every ranking that has been released per NFL and other media outlets.

NFC West Odds

Even in their own division, the NFC West, which has been a gauntlet the last 3-4 seasons. The Cardinals are dead last and by a huge gap.

The other three teams in the division are all closely priced at pretty small odds, while the Cardinals have the longest odds to win the division in the entire league. They are more than double the odds placed on the second longest team. Las Vegas Raiders are the only other team over +1000 to win the division, the Raiders are +1100 or 11/1.

Then there are the Cardinals, doubling that number and leaving a tip. Arizona is +2500 or 25/1 to win the NFC West. While the favorites are the 49ers are -182. They are followed by the Seahawks at +325, and then the Rams at +450.

One thing is certain, the bookmakers do not think highly of the Arizona Cardinals.
